Edge Computing Takes Flight: Axiom Space and Red Hat Reach for the Stars

The final frontier is about to get a whole lot smarter. In an exciting collaboration, Axiom Space and Red Hat are teaming up to bring the power of edge computing to the International Space Station (ISS). This groundbreaking project promises to redefine how data is processed in orbit, opening up new possibilities for research, experimentation, and space exploration.

What is Edge Computing, and Why Does it Matter in Space?

Before we dive into the details, let’s quickly define edge computing. Traditionally, data collected in space (from experiments, sensors, etc.) had to be transmitted back to Earth for processing. This is a time-consuming process, hampered by latency (delays in communication) and bandwidth limitations. Imagine trying to download a large file with a dial-up connection – that’s a simplified analogy of the challenges faced in space-based data transmission.

Edge computing solves this problem by bringing the processing power closer to the source of the data. Instead of sending everything back to Earth, computations can be performed directly on the ISS. This dramatically reduces latency and frees up valuable bandwidth for other critical communications.

Key Benefits of Edge Computing in Space:

  • Reduced Latency: Faster data processing means quicker insights and faster response times for experiments and operations.
  • Bandwidth Optimization: Less data needs to be transmitted to Earth, freeing up bandwidth for other vital communications.
  • Increased Autonomy: Onboard processing allows for more autonomous decision-making by spacecraft and experiments, reducing reliance on ground control.
  • Enhanced Resilience: Even if communication with Earth is disrupted, critical data processing can continue onboard.
  • Real-Time Analysis: Enables real-time analysis of data from scientific experiments, allowing for immediate adjustments and optimizations.

Axiom Space and Red Hat: A Partnership for the Future

This spring, Axiom Space and Red Hat will launch the Data Center Unit-1 (AxDCU-1) to the ISS. This isn’t your typical server room; AxDCU-1 is a small, lightweight data processing prototype specifically designed for the harsh environment of space. It’s described as being powered by “lightweight, edge-op[timized]” technology, suggesting a focus on energy efficiency and robust performance within the constraints of a space-based environment.

This project is a significant step towards creating a more robust and efficient IT infrastructure in orbit. It represents a shift from relying solely on Earth-based resources to building a truly distributed computing network that extends beyond our planet.

The Potential Impact: Revolutionizing Space Exploration

The implications of bringing edge computing to the ISS are far-reaching. Consider these potential applications:

  • Accelerated Scientific Discovery: Researchers can analyze experimental data in real-time, enabling faster iterations and potentially leading to breakthroughs in fields like medicine, materials science, and biology.
  • Improved Spacecraft Operations: Edge computing can enhance the autonomy of spacecraft, allowing them to make quicker decisions and react to changing conditions without constant input from ground control.
  • Support for Future Missions: As we venture further into space, to the Moon and Mars, the need for reliable, low-latency data processing will become even more critical. This project lays the groundwork for the infrastructure needed to support these ambitious missions.
  • Commercial Opportunities: The development of space-based data centers opens up new commercial opportunities, from providing cloud services in orbit to supporting in-space manufacturing and resource utilization.
  • Enabling AI and Machine Learning in Space: Edge computing provides the necessary processing power to run complex AI and machine learning algorithms directly on the ISS, enabling advanced data analysis and autonomous systems.
